Women's World Cup: India Fined 5 per Cent Match Fee for Slow over-Rate Against Australia | Sports-Games

  • The ICC fined the Indian women's cricket team five percent of their match fee for a slow over-rate against Australia during the ICC Women's Cricket World Cup on October 12, 2025, as confirmed by the ICC.
  • India was one over short of their target according to time allowances considered during the match, which was sanctioned by Michell Periera of the Emirates ICC International Panel of Match Referees.
  • Australia, led by Alyssa Healy's 142 runs, achieved the highest successful run chase in women's ODI history, securing a three-wicket victory against India.
  • India will face England next after currently sitting fifth in the points table following the loss to Australia.
